The Tenant of Wildfell Hall by Anne Brontë

I found this book incredibly compelling despite my distaste for its narrator, who struck me as crude, imperceptive, hasty, and altogether unlikeable. I liked being a better reader of his story than he was, however, and I like Helen Huntington--who may be the most realistic Victorian heroine I've ever read.
